About Ashlin R. Michell
Ashlin R. Michell is a scholar working on Immunology,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Biomedical Engineering, Infectious Diseases and Small Animals, having authored 7 papers that have together received 166 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Complement system in diseases (2 papers), Monoclonal and Polyclonal Antibodies Research (2 papers), 3D Printing in Biomedical Research (2 papers), Cardiac electrophysiology and arrhythmias (1 paper), HIV Research and Treatment (1 paper),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(1 paper), Neuroscience and Neural Engineering (1 paper) and Blood groups and transfusion (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Immunology (71 citations), Infectious Diseases (62 citations), Virology (14 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(36 citations) and Epidemiology (28 citations). Ashlin R. Michell has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include Jonathan K. Fallon, Galit Alter, Todd J. Suscovich, Stephanie Fischinger, Hendrik Streeck, Thomas Broge, Salman R. Khetani, Douglas A. Lauffenburger, Alfred L. George and Dawood Darbar. Their work appears in journals such as Science Advances, The Journal of Infectious Diseases, npj Vaccines, Med and Journal of Immunological Methods.
